Magnificent Mile
Upscale shopping district with luxury department stores, boutiques, and acclaimed restaurants, featuring landmarks like the Wrigley Building and Chicago Water Tower. The Magnificent Mile is easily accessible by public transit and seasonal trolley service.

What can I expect from 3-star hotels in Chicago?
When you book a 3-star hotel in Chicago, you can expect a clean and functional place to stay with the essential amenities you need for a comfortable stay. Rooms typically boast basic furnishings and facilities, like private bathrooms with hot and cold water, Wi-Fi, TV, and a wardrobe. A standard three-star hotel in Chicago usually offers breakfast in the on-site restaurant, while some even offer lunch and dinner. In some cases, you may encounter mid-range properties with pools and gyms with basic equipment. How do 3-star hotels in Chicago compare to local guesthouses or boutique hotels?
3-star hotels in Chicago typically offer more standardized services and amenities compared to local guesthouses and boutique hotels. You'll usually find a dedicated 24-hour front desk, daily housekeeping, and on-site dining options at 3-star hotels. Rooms tend to be more uniform in size and layout, too, with standard furnishings and facilities like TV, linen, and Wi-Fi. Local guesthouses and boutiques may boast a more local and distinct character, but which services, amenities, and facilities are included depends on each property.
